Financial Consequences of Security Attacks

If your business suffers a cyber attack, the financial impacts can be severe. You may face immediate costs for recovery efforts, including hiring cybersecurity experts and repairing damaged systems. In addition, there are often hidden costs like lost productivity and disrupted operations that can persist long after the attack. You could also face legal fees if sensitive customer information is compromised, potentially bringing potential lawsuits and fines. Your insurance premiums may go up, adding to your long-term expenses. If you depend on third-party vendors, their vulnerabilities could also influence your financial stability. Ultimately, the cumulative effect of these factors can severely strain your budget, making it vital to invest in modern security services to mitigate these risks and protect your bottom line.

Fundamental Aspects of Full-Scale Security Services

Effective security services rest upon several essential components that work together to create a solid protection framework. First, risk assessment helps identify vulnerabilities and prioritize threats, confirming your resources focus where they're needed most. Next, integrated technology, such as surveillance cameras and access control systems, supplies real-time monitoring and data collection. Training personnel to recognize security issues is also critical; well-prepared staff can act rapidly in emergencies. Additionally, incident response plans are vital for minimizing damage when breaches occur. Finally, regular audits and updates confirm your security measures adapt to evolving threats. By incorporating these components, you'll create a complete security service that effectively protects your assets and enhances overall safety.

Choosing the Ideal Security Service for Your Requirements

How do you determine which security service is ideal for your specific needs? Initiate by analyzing your risks and vulnerabilities. Pinpoint what assets you need to secure—whether it's physical property, data, or personnel. Next, analyze the type of security service that suits your situation. Do you need armed guards, surveillance systems, or cybersecurity solutions? Consider your budget and the level of expertise necessary. Research potential providers, looking for reviews and their experience in your industry. Don't be afraid to ask questions about their protocols and technologies. Finally, ensure the service can respond to your changing needs. By taking these steps, you'll be more ready to pick a security service that provides effective protection customized to your unique circumstances.

Emerging Security Trends: Anticipated Changes in Security Services

As technological advancements progress, protection services must transform to counter developing dangers and issues. You can anticipate an heightened emphasis on AI-driven security solutions, which can analyze data in real-time to identify irregularities and stop security breaches before they escalate. Moreover, the rise of remote work will demand more advanced cybersecurity measures, guaranteeing that sensitive information remains safeguarded outside traditional office environments. Biometric verification and facial recognition will likely become standard features, enhancing access control. Additionally, adoption of IoT devices in security systems will streamline monitoring processes. As these trends unfold, it's essential to stay informed and prepared to leverage new technologies to protect your assets successfully. Accepting these changes will be vital for ensuring your security remains solid.
